In my book Distant Waves the hero would be Jane. Jane is the second oldest of 5 girls, Mimi, Jane, Emma, Amelie, and Blythe. In Distant Waves, Jane has to look after the younger children when her oldest sister, Mimi, leaves for Fance. I think that Jane is Loyal to her family because she proves countless times that she would do anything for her sisters. "We clung together there, rocking, a pile of teay-eyed females, cosumed with sisterly love for each other, desperate to assure Mimi that it didn't matter if she was our half sister. Our love for her whole, complete and unconditional." Suzanne Weyn; Pg. 68
